What affects the price

Figuring out what a garage door repair will run depends on a few specific variables. The main factor is whether the issue is mechanical—like a broken spring, frayed cable, or a faulty motor—or if the door panels themselves are damaged. Parts quality and the size or weight of your door also play a role in the total. What's the process for replacing a single car garage door?

Replacing a single car garage door begins with removing the old door and its hardware. The new door is then carefully assembled and mounted onto the tracks. The opener, if being replaced simultaneously, is installed and connected. Finally, the counterbalance system, typically springs, is adjusted to ensure the door operates smoothly and safely. This entire process can take several hours.

What is a chain drive garage door opener?

A chain drive garage door opener uses a chain, similar to a bicycle chain, to move the trolley along a steel rail. This mechanism connects to the garage door to lift and lower it. Chain drive openers are known for their durability and strength, often being a more budget-friendly option. However, they can be noisier than other types of openers.

How do I fix garage door sensors if they're not working?

If your garage door sensors aren't working in Riverside, first check for obvious obstructions like cobwebs or debris. Ensure the indicator lights on both sensors are illuminated. If not, try cleaning the lenses and then carefully realigning them by adjusting their position. If the problem persists, the sensors may need professional diagnosis or replacement.

What are the benefits of steel garage doors?

Steel garage doors offer significant advantages in terms of durability and security for Riverside homeowners. They are resistant to dents, cracks, and warping, and with proper finishing, they can withstand various weather conditions. Many steel doors also feature insulation, which can improve your home's energy efficiency by regulating temperature within the garage.

What is involved in installing a LiftMaster garage door opener?

Installing a LiftMaster garage door opener involves mounting the motor unit above the garage door opening. The opener's arm is then attached to the garage door itself. Wiring is run from the motor unit to a power source, and safety sensors are installed at the bottom of the door. Finally, the opener is programmed to work with your remote controls and tested for proper operation.

What does garage door spring replacement entail?

Garage door spring replacement is a critical safety procedure performed by trained professionals. It involves carefully releasing the tension from the broken spring and removing it. The new spring, matched precisely to the weight and size of your garage door, is then installed and tensioned. This ensures the door operates smoothly and can be lifted manually if needed.

What is the process for garage door opener installation?

Garage door opener installation starts with mounting the opener motor unit. The drive mechanism, whether a chain, belt, or screw, is then installed along the track above the door. The opener arm is attached to the door, and all necessary wiring is completed. Safety sensors are positioned at the bottom of the door, and the system is tested for proper functionality and safety features.
